  • the invention relates to a paper transport device between a working according to the inkjet principle plotter for large-scale paper sheet, a transfer part and a subsequent folder and a method for operating such a paper transport device.
  • the commercially available plates for printing large-area paper sheets work according to the xerographic process, which enables continuous sheet output, which is expedient for the subsequent folding process in online mode.
  • loop formations and corresponding sensors between rolls, printer and folder according to the document US-A-4,611,799 only serve to control the presence of paper. Any additional information is not intended or disclosed.
  • the object to be achieved by the invention is to provide means which allow an inkjet-printing plotter to be connected directly to a folder without the latter having to stop in an unfavorable moment for the folding operations.
  • the paper transport device is used to supply relatively large-area paper sheet 3 from a plotter 1 to a folding machine, hereafter referred to as moth.

  • the lower part of the inlet lock 4 is formed by a movably mounted flap 5.
  • the inlet of the paper leading edge is monitored by a sensor 6.
  • the paper tape 3 Upon further movement of the paper sheet 3 in the direction of arrow A, the paper tape 3 enters the region of a Fixierklemme 10 and a subsequent sensor 13th
  • the paper loop 9 is formed by being close to the inlet area the electromagnetically actuated, acting as retaining members Fixierklemme 10 of the Matterleiters 7 is brought by a sensor 13 influenced by control means in clamping position and thus the paper sheet 3 is clamped on the transfer part 7. At the same time, the flap 5 reaches its lowered position, as can be seen from FIG.
  • the lower rollers of the drive roller pairs 8 are driven together, preferably by a toothed belt continuously by a separate drive.
  • the upper rollers of the drive roller pairs 8 are without their own drive on the interposed paper tape.
  • the paper sheet 3 is supplied to the folder 2 with a speed matched to the drive speed of the folder 2, wherein the loop supply is continuously used up.
  • the paper loop 9 As soon as the paper loop 9 has reached a predetermined minimum size, this is detected by another sensor 18.
  • the control device now causes the folder 2 to stop until the sensor 12 again detects a large loop formation.
  • the interruption of the moth operation is possibly controlled by means of delay means so that it is not interrupted in a critical for the folding operation phase. Of the described process of wrinkling is repeated until the end of the paper sheet, whereupon again the situation described in Figure 1 and the flap 5 is raised.

Dispositif de transport de papier comprenant une section de transfert (7) qui est placée entre un traceur à jet d'encre pour feuilles de papier de grande de surface et une plieuse (2) raccordée à ladite section de transfert et qui comporte des rouleaux d'entraînement (8), un agencement de capteurs (6, 18, 12), des moyens de commande des rouleaux d'entraînement (8) et des organes de retenue de papier (10, 26),
    caractérisé en ce que les organes de retenue de papier (10, 26), qui peuvent être facultativement actionnés et qui sont destinés à former une boucle de papier (9, 20, 24), sont disposés de façon à équilibrer la sortie de papier, à fonctionnement discontinu, du traceur (1), l'agencement de capteurs (6, 18, 12), qui est relié au dispositif de commande et qui permet de déterminer la présence de papier et une longueur minimale respectivement une longueur maximale de la boucle de papier (9) servant à commander au dispositif de commande de libérer la feuille de papier pour la transporter dans la plieuse (2) lorsque la boucle de papier (9) atteint une longueur maximale prescrite, tandis que la plieuse (2) peut être arrêtée lorsque la boucle de papier (9) atteint une dimension minimale prescrite, ce processus pouvant être répété jusqu'au bout de la feuille de papier.
